你查询的IP:[117.80.21.82]  地理位置:中国–江苏–苏州电信

最新查询60.255.223.65 121.255.105.86 203.192.75.94 124.88.1.37 125.210.49.191 117.76.136.255 122.8.81.145 166.111.134.58 203.86.59.128 117.80.21.82 221.192.155.218 121.248.221.7 58.144.28.185 122.192.164.73 221.122.114.222 122.102.64.12 202.127.48.162 202.69.4.38 118.132.202.29 116.116.198.201 119.42.85.54 122.240.42.178 116.4.183.81 61.29.128.229 120.90.242.158 61.8.160.116 202.141.160.140 221.13.2.223 119.248.33.246 202.38.169.125 118.88.128.197